TVS MOTORS (Saikrishna Automotives) - Reviews

* — Please fill out

TVS MOTORS (Saikrishna Automotives)

OLD NH, TEKKALI OPP GOVT DEGREE COLLEGE TEKKALI, SRIKAKULAM, Andhra Pradesh 532201

View Business Profile